p>Unison Health is seeking a Substance Abuse Specialist to join our Assertive Community Treatment (ACT) Program, an evidence-based model of delivering comprehensive community-based behavioral health services to adults with serious and persistent mental illnesses who have not benefited from traditional outpatient treatment. The ACT model utilizes a multidisciplinary team of providers who work closely together to deliver services designed to meet clients’ needs, including substance use treatment, vocational support, and coordinated team-based care.
